Florida gun bill succeeds despite detractors
Governor Charlie Crist promises to sign the new guns-to-work bill when it crosses his desk, saying that the “2nd Amendment is very important… …people being protected is most important to me.”
The law, fresh from a Senate victory, will bar employers from banning guns on their premises, provided workers hold concealed-weapons permits and leave the guns [...]
